Вопросы по теме 'pg-promise'

Соединения с использованием pg-promise
Итак, я использую pg-promise для запроса моей базы данных. Поскольку я использую heroku postgres (бесплатная версия), максимальное количество подключений — 20. Для подключения к БД я использую pgp(process.env.DATABASE_URL +...
2469 просмотров
schedule 02.11.2022

пропустить столбцы обновления с помощью pg-promise
У меня есть API на узле, использующий pg-promise для Postgres, это работает хорошо, но я думаю о том, как изменить оператор PUT, чтобы немного лучше обрабатывать NULLS на входе. Ниже приведен код оператора PUT: //UPDATE a single record...
2426 просмотров
schedule 23.10.2023

pg-promise ответ на транзакцию
Так что я немного застрял здесь. У меня есть объект, например: var lineItems = [ { id: 1, quantity: 10 }, { id: 2, quantity: 15 }, { id: 4, quantity: 22 } ] теперь мне нужно...
2314 просмотров
schedule 08.06.2024

pg-promise ColumnSet использует функции Postgres со свойством def
Я использую ColumnSet и Функция helper.insert для многострочной вставки . У меня есть столбец таблицы, в котором я хочу использовать Postgres Дата/время сейчас() . const cs = new helpers.ColumnSet([ 'lastname', { name:...
747 просмотров
schedule 07.10.2022

pg-обещание. Запрос работает при использовании необработанного запроса, но не при использовании помощников
Я получаю сообщение об ошибке, когда использую следующий код: var rows = [{"alex", "matos"},{"john","carmack"}] const cs = pg.pgp.helpers.ColumnSet( ["name","lastname"], { table: "user.user_data" } ); const query =...
503 просмотров
schedule 27.05.2024

Как правильно писать запросы с нулевым ограничением в pg-promise?
При написании запросов Postgres ограничения обычно записываются как WHERE a = $(a) или WHERE b IN $(b:csv) , если вы знаете, что это список. Однако, если значение равно null , ограничение должно быть записано как WHERE x IS NULL . Можно ли...
273 просмотров
schedule 12.04.2024

pg-promise, разрешающий несколько запросов в функции карты
связанные с pg- транзакция обещания с зависимыми запросами в цикле forEach выдает предупреждение Ошибка: запрос об освобожденном или потерянном соединении , теперь я пытаюсь вернуть несколько запросов из функции карты const {db} =...
243 просмотров
schedule 07.02.2024